Tianjin Dispatches over 12,000 TEUs on China-Europe (Central Asia) Freight Trains in Jan-Feb

03-16-2026

A report from en.tj.gov.cn Mar. 12th, 2026:

Tianjin Port dispatched 117 China-Europe (Central Asia) freight trains carrying 12,558 twenty-foot equivalent units (TEUs) from January to February, up 5.4 percent and 4.6 percent year-on-year, respectively.

The steady growth of the Tianjin-Europe (Central Asia) freight train service reflects China's continued efforts to advance high-level opening-up. The service now covers the eastern, central, and western railway corridors, injecting fresh momentum into high-quality Belt and Road Initiative cooperation and providing strong support for regional economic development.

According to Yang Xuehua, manager of an international freight forwarding company, demand for rail freight services in Tianjin has increased significantly. After the SCO summit last year, Tianjin launched a new scheduled service to Horgos in Xinjiang Uygur autonomous region, attracting more clients outside of Tianijn.

To ensure smooth operations, Tianjin Customs has introduced a green channel and one-stop services for China-Europe freight trains, allowing rapid customs clearance and improving logistics efficiency.
